O que exatamente é um modelo de servidor Web pré-fork?

Quero saber exatamente o que significa quando um servidor web se descreve como um servidor web pré-fork. Eu tenho alguns exemplos comounicórnio para rubi egunicorn para python.

Mais especificamente, estas são as perguntas:

Que problema esse modelo resolve?O que acontece quando um servidor Web pré-fork é iniciado inicialmente?Como ele lida com a solicitação?

Além disso, uma pergunta mais específica para unicórnio / gunicorn:

Digamos que eu tenho um aplicativo da web que desejo executar com o (g) unicorn. Na inicialização, o aplicativo da Web fará algumas coisas de inicialização (por exemplo, preencha entradas adicionais do banco de dados). Se eu configurar o (g) unicórnio com vários trabalhadores, o material de inicialização será executado várias vezes?

questionAnswers(1)

yourAnswerToTheQuestion